Lafayette & Comstock
2975 Lafayette St
Santa Clara, CA 95054
The bus stop at Lafayette & Comstock in Santa Clara, CA, serves as a convenient transit hub for local commuters. It is surrounded by residential neighborhoods and close to nearby parks, making it a vital link for residents and travelers alike. With benches and a shelter available, they provide a comfortable waiting area for passengers while they anticipate their bus arrivals. Easy access to surrounding streets and local businesses makes this stop a well-utilized point in the community.
Generated from this place's information
Also at this address
See a problem?